2014-03-17 5 views
0

Недавно мы разработали довольно большое приложение, которое сильно зависит от задней части веб-сервера, и мы решили перейти на маршрут iframed web-app, поскольку мы чувствовали, что он будет намного меньше напрягать устройство. Это в основном эквивалент приложения на банковском уровне.Apple Store и приложения Iframe

Когда мы отправили его в iTunes Store, они в основном заявили, что веб-приложения такого типа не разрешены, поэтому уходите!

Вот вопрос, есть ли способ, которым любой знает, чтобы это приложение разрешалось магазином приложений? Каков общепринятый метод получения приложений такого рода на устройствах iOS? Я также не могу найти информацию о том, как «веб-приложения» распространяются на устройства Apple через ad-hoc, у кого есть дополнительная информация об этом?

+0

Основная проблема с этим приложением заключается в том, что вы можете изменить способ работы. Это то, что Apple не ослабевает. Таким образом, нет никакого способа получить приложение, которое является просто веб-сайтом, в Appstore. – rckoenes

ответ

1

Apple, начал отвергать простые приложения или приложения, которые просто обернуть вокруг сайта, причина используется идентификатор обычно:

2,12: приложения, которые не очень полезны, это просто веб-сайты в комплекте, как приложения, или не обеспечивают непреходящую ценность развлечения могут быть отвергнут

решение может быть интегрировать некоторые конкретные рамки IOS: такие, как социальные, AVFoundation, CoreLocation и т.д.

1

Другой подход - просто установить ссылку на ваш сайт на device as an icon.

Это имеет то преимущество, что Apple не требует одобрения, но пользователь не может установить ярлык из App Store - им нужно перейти на ваш сайт и разрешить установку с помощью JavaScript.

4

Это было решено - Apple App Store принимает приложения с iFrames, которые позволяют внедрять веб-сайты и распространять их как приложения. Хотя HTML5 iFrames не лучший способ сделать это, вы все равно можете это сделать, если хотите. То, что здесь произошло, это клиент, который был создан для настоящих, чтобы предоставить свои собственные значки для приложения, и оказалось, что, хотя значки выглядели правильными, они были на 1 или 2 пикселя, поэтому Apple отклонила приложение. После того, как вы проигнорировали клиента и предоставили мою собственную, приложение было принято и отправлено вживую. С тех пор было сделано несколько обновлений, и все они были приняты.

Как я уже упоминал ранее, HTML iFrames - это не лучший способ сделать это, поскольку есть ошибки в том, как решение HTML iFrame + Phonegap обрабатывает определенные функции. Лучшим решением для такого приложения на устройстве iOS является использование веб-представления (UIWebView). Вот ссылки на несколько обучающих программ, которые помогут вам получить это происходит,

Благодаря тем, кто помог в этом.

Смежные вопросы